WCCS PROUDLY RECOGNIZES THE TEACHER AND STAFF MEMBER OF THE MONTH FOR JANUARY

Whitley County Consolidated Schools congratulates the January Teacher of the Month and Staff of the Month winners.

Erica Witt, Third Grade teacher at Northern Heights Elementary School, was recognized as the teacher of the month for January 2026.

"Miss Witt is an exceptional educator. She communicates clearly and consistently with parents, creating a strong partnership that supports each student's success. In the classroom, she holds high expectations while encouraging students to be the best version of themselves -- she's passionate, energetic, and enthusiastic with her instruction and with making sure every student who passes through her room knows they are loved," said Witt's nominator.

Sean Johnston, Computer Technical for for Whitley County Consolidated Schools, was recognized as the Staff Member of the Month for January 2026.

Sean has a heart for helping and for serving. He has taken it upon himself to clean and organize the technology area at Indian Springs Middle School so that he could be more present in the building to support student and staff needs throughout the day. I've never heard Sean say "no" -- when he's able to provide support or assistance, in any way, he's always willing, whether it's related to technology or just lending a helping hand to support the needs of the school or of teachers."

Each month, nominations are taken from co-workers, families, and the community and then winners are chosen from a selection committee made up of community members, service organizations, a WCCS School Board member, and WCCS staff.

Through May, we will honor a WCCS teacher and a WCCS staff member who go above and beyond, demonstrating a steadfast commitment to academic excellence, innovative teaching methods, and fostering a positive, engaging learning environment. These exemplary educators embody the WCCS values of Eagle P.R.I.D.E. - Persistence, Respectfulness, Initiative, Dependability, and Efficiency.
